Bengaluru: Ramakrishna Math to host week-long multi-lingual Bhajana Saptaaha
Ramakrishna Math Bengaluru hosts Bhajana Saptaaha

The Ramakrishna Math in Basavanagudi, Bengaluru, is set to host a week-long multi-lingual Bhajana Saptaaha from March 16 to 22. The event will feature devotional music and chanting in multiple languages, aiming to foster spiritual harmony.

Event Schedule and Highlights

The Bhajana Saptaaha will commence on March 16 with an inaugural ceremony at 6:30 PM, followed by daily sessions from 6:00 PM to 8:30 PM. Each day will focus on a different language, including Kannada, Telugu, Tamil, Malayalam, Hindi, and Sanskrit. The finale on March 22 will feature a grand concert by renowned artists.

Participation and Activities

Devotees and music lovers can attend the sessions free of cost. The event will include bhajans, kirtans, and discourses on the teachings of Sri Ramakrishna. Special arrangements have been made for seating and parking. The Math encourages people from all walks of life to participate and experience the divine atmosphere.

Significance of the Event

The Bhajana Saptaaha is an annual tradition that promotes inter-lingual and inter-cultural unity through music. It provides a platform for artists to showcase their talent and for devotees to immerse in spiritual bliss. The Ramakrishna Math has been organizing this event for several years, attracting large crowds.
